Red eye tree frog

Frogs absorb water through their skin rather than drinking with their mouths. As a result, they tend to spend long periods of time just sitting in their water baths or ponds. This water should be dechlorinated, if possible.

The Red-Eyed Tree Frog will eat mostly insects (moths, crickets, grasshoppers, flies) and also smaller frogs as it is a carnivorous animal
